Mn₂CrAl is an intermetallic compound belonging to the Heusler alloy family, characterized by a specific stoichiometric composition of manganese, chromium, and aluminum. This material is primarily of research and development interest rather than established in high-volume production, being investigated for potential applications in magnetic and structural applications due to the magnetic properties inherent to manganese-based intermetallics. It represents an emerging class of materials where composition tailoring aims to achieve desirable combinations of magnetic behavior, thermal stability, and mechanical performance for next-generation engineering systems.
